I used TJ rears to lift my sagging rear. I installed a custom set of ALCAN 1" lift front leaf springs (that I bought on a factory overstock sale for something like $199for the pair w/poly bushing kit) that ended up giving me about 1-1/2" of lift. Then I installed the TJ rears over my tired rear leafs. Lo and behold! A miracle! My truck was perfectly level. Of course I normally have about 200 - 400lbs of tools in my bed with a fiberglass cap mounted as well. The ride is a little stiff, but much better than hitting the bump stops all the time <img src="/forums/images/graemlins/wink.gif" alt="" /> Now I need new shocks and I find that the stock Billys I was planning on using are too short for the increased lift. -- Matt
